New Food Finds

  • Craisins’ Cranberries 100-Calorie Packs, Costco, $5.99 (there was a $2 off manuf. coupon)

Photobucket

36 100-calorie packs for $5.99 comes out to $0.17 a bag! wowza! I like to carry bagged cranberries in my purse and love when they’re pre-portioned because, as with almonds, I have little self-control eating them from the bag and could easily consume hundreds of calories in one sitting!

  • Trader Joe’s All-Natural Flavored Waters in Mint and Lime, $0.99

Photobucket

While I’m generally opposed to paying for bottled water, I think this is a good alternative for people who get bored drinking water or have trouble drinking it enough. This also reminded me to brighten up my own water jugs at home by adding lemon slices and mint! How refreshing! :D
